Class A Driver
Grow West is looking for an individual who can drive a delivery truck including light duty, heavy duty, flat bed or tanker and delivers either packaged or bulk fertilizers, chemicals or any other company commodity to clients by performing the following duties.
Duties and Responsibilities include the following. Other duties may be assigned.
- Delivers merchandise to customers in a timely manner
- Fills delivery orders by obtaining the required merchandise and completes appropriate paperwork.*
- Verifies accuracy of order including product type and quantity with delivery tickets, invoices and shipping documents and adjusts as necessary.*
- Operates company vehicle in a professional, safe and courteous manner and maintains the inside and outside of vehicle to company standards.*
- Secures all loads properly and adheres to all DOT regulations.*
- Keeps accurate time records.*
- Assists with stocking the shipping and receiving department to include lifting and carrying products and placing them in the appropriate place.*
- Returns credit merchandise with appropriate paperwork and informs management of delivery.*
- Picks up merchandise and invoices from warehouse and vendors.*
- Provides customer with receipt and/or credit form for merchandise to be picked up.*
- Performs a daily pre-trip inspection on vehicle and trailer and reports malfunctions to management.*
- Maintains ability to work evenings, weekends and during declared emergency situations.*
- Performs other related duties at assigned.

Education/Experience:
One year experience in class A vehicle operation; or equivalent combination of education and experience.
Specialized Training:
Must maintain current status on Federal DOT Hazmat requirements every three years
Certificates and Licenses:
· Valid Class A CDL with Hazmat, tanker, doubles and triples endorsements
· Must have acceptable motor vehicle report
· Must maintain current status on DOT medical certification
Equipment:
· Forklift
· Hand Truck
· Pallet Jack
· Pickup - One Ton Truck
· Tank Truck
